Transaction 721f5208df25514d3d8686b92995ea432bc354029a686cf84a5c5bcca16388bf

1 Input
2 Outputs
  • 721f5208df25514d3d8686b92995ea432bc354029a686cf84a5c5bcca16388bf:0
  • value  249342
    address  3DM8MKDqvzoHHV5xEHc7CTaj8cSn6KHGme
  • 721f5208df25514d3d8686b92995ea432bc354029a686cf84a5c5bcca16388bf:1
  • value  4481665
    address  12CEGPkTGF5GAa59FPZRm4jv8Kzt5KSTjZ